diff --git a/src/KeySend.cpp b/src/KeySend.cpp
new file mode 100644
index 0000000..cfd7f3c
--- /dev/null
+++ b/src/KeySend.cpp
@@ -0,0 +1,99 @@
+#include <windows.h>
+#include <winuser.h>
+#include <stdio.h>
+
+#include "KeySend.h"
+
+CKeySend::CKeySend()
+{
+}
+
+CKeySend::~CKeySend()
+{
+}
+
+
+void CKeySend::SendKeyDown(unsigned char bVk)
+{
+ BYTE bScan = LOBYTE(::MapVirtualKey(bVk, 0));
+ DWORD dwFlags = (IsVkExtended(bVk) ? KEYEVENTF_EXTENDEDKEY : 0 );
+ KeyboardEvent(bVk,bScan,dwFlags);
+}
+
+void CKeySend::SendKeyUp(unsigned char bVk)
+{
+ BYTE bScan = LOBYTE(::MapVirtualKey(bVk, 0));
+ DWORD dwFlags = (IsVkExtended(bVk) ? KEYEVENTF_EXTENDEDKEY : 0 ) | KEYEVENTF_KEYUP;
+ KeyboardEvent(bVk,bScan,dwFlags);
+}
+
+void CKeySend::KeyboardEvent(unsigned char bVk, unsigned char bScan, unsigned long dwFlags)
+{
+ ::keybd_event(bVk, bScan, dwFlags, 0);
+}
+
+bool CKeySend::IsVkExtended(unsigned char bVk)
+{
+ bool bExtended = false;
+ if( (bVk == VK_UP ) ||
+ (bVk == VK_DOWN ) ||
+ (bVk == VK_LEFT ) ||
+ (bVk == VK_RIGHT ) ||
+ (bVk == VK_HOME ) ||
+ (bVk == VK_END ) ||
+ (bVk == VK_PRIOR ) ||
+ (bVk == VK_NEXT ) ||
+ (bVk == VK_INSERT ) ||
+ (bVk == VK_DELETE ) ||
+ (bVk == VK_UP ) )
+ {
+ bExtended = true;
+ }
+ return bExtended;
+
+}
+
+int CKeySend::MapDfbKeyEventToVK(unsigned short symbol)
+{
+ switch(symbol)
+ {
+ case 0xF000 : return VK_LEFT;
+ case 0xF001 : return VK_RIGHT;
+ case 0xF002 : return VK_UP;
+ case 0xF003 : return VK_DOWN;
+ case 0xF00b : return VK_RETURN;
+
+ case 0xF046 : return VK_PRIOR; //p+
+ case 0xF047 : return VK_NEXT; //p-
+
+ case 0xF050 : return -1; // play
+ case 0xF05A : return -1; // FF
+ case 0xF059 : return -1; // rew
+ case 0xF052 : return -1; // stop
+ case 0xF056 : return -1; // REC
+
+ case 0xF05B : return VK_BACK; // back key
+
+ case 0xF042 : return -1; // Red
+ case 0xF043 : return -1; // Green
+ case 0xF045 : return -1; // Blue
+
+ case 0xF011 : return -1; // options
+ case 0xF032 : return -1; // teletext
+ case 0xF014 : return -1; // info
+
+ case 0x0030 : return 0x30; // 0-9
+ case 0x0031 : return 0x31; // 0-9
+ case 0x0032 : return 0x32; // 0-9
+ case 0x0033 : return 0x33; // 0-9
+ case 0x0034 : return 0x34; // 0-9
+ case 0x0035 : return 0x35; // 0-9
+ case 0x0036 : return 0x36; // 0-9
+ case 0x0037 : return 0x37; // 0-9
+ case 0x0038 : return 0x38; // 0-9
+ case 0x0039 : return 0x39; // 0-9
+ default:
+ return -1;
+ }
+ return -1;
+}
